Meaning & origin

Castiel is a modern invented name that first appeared in U.S. baby name records in 2009, coinciding with the debut of the television series 'Supernatural.' Its popularity rose steadily, reaching a peak rank in 2019 before declining slightly. By 2025, the name ranked 1008th, with about 1 in 7,625 newborn boys receiving the name. The name is most common in New Mexico, Arizona, and Oklahoma, suggesting a regional concentration. Its unique sound and angelic associations have contributed to its appeal among fans of the show and parents seeking distinctive names. Despite its modern roots, Castiel has established a notable presence in contemporary naming.

Castiel is a modern invented name, likely created for the television series 'Supernatural' (2008). It may have been modeled after angelic names ending in -el (e.g., Gabriel, Michael) combined with a unique beginning. The name entered the U.S. Social Security baby name data in 2009 following the show's debut.
